The Gringo Hunters is a 2025 Mexican-American action crime drama series directed by Alonso Alvarez, Adrian Grunberg, Natalia Beristain, and Jimena Montemayor, following a specialist Mexican police unit whose mission is to capture criminals — many of them American — who have crossed the border into Mexico to evade justice.
What is The Gringo Hunters about?
When wanted fugitives slip across the US-Mexico border seeking refuge from American law enforcement, a tight-knit squad of Mexican officers takes up the pursuit. Operating in terrain that conventional authorities struggle to navigate, this unit specializes in tracking suspects who believe distance and jurisdiction will protect them. Each episode unfolds a distinct manhunt, exposing the political friction, street-level danger, and moral grey zones that define cross-border law enforcement. The series balances procedural tension with character work, showing what the officers sacrifice to bring their targets in.
Cast & crew
Manuel Masalva and Hector Kotsifakis anchor the ensemble as key members of the fugitive-hunting unit, joined by Harold Torres and Mayra Hermosillo in supporting roles. Sebastian Roché and Andrew Leland Rogers bring international dimension to the cast, while Dagoberto Gama and Regina Nava round out the Mexican side of the story with grounded, textured performances throughout the series.
